Transaction 51ab60ef830cf604f81b2744c748874145c7dc469e1b0dc8bab93c683554ac3f
1 Input
1 Output
-
51ab60ef830cf604f81b2744c748874145c7dc469e1b0dc8bab93c683554ac3f:0
- value
- 96836
- script pubkey
- OP_0 OP_PUSHBYTES_20 7d5252682c03def5a343385107a535e076d7eac7
- address
- bc1q04f9y6pvq000tg6r8pgs0ff4upmd06k8fyt2f0